Someone needs to write an overheating thread and sticky that bitch!
Things to check: 1. Radiator cap;it's cheap, and causes more problems than you can imagine. 2. Thermostat; also cheap 3. Flush, clean, and pressure test radiator and hoses (make sure they are on properly and not bent shut, or have holes). Also watch while the car is running to make sure there isn't a hose collapsing in on it's self. 4. Listen for knock; detonation causes overheating (cheap gas, improper timing, etc.). 5. Water pump. 6. Fans coming on at proper temp. 7.. Finally, Thor's favorite....blown HG. Look for drop in coolant level, white smoke, water in oil, and excessive pressure on the hoses. Re: 91 talon overheating dont know y
you might have air in the coolign system, when you run your car, run it with the heater on, then after you turn it off and cooled down, take of the radiator cap and squeeze the rubber pipe which goes between the radiator and the thermostat housign to let air bubbles out, you can do vise versa too.
